Natural Insect Deterrents



To maintain bugs away from your yard normally, plant aromatic natural herbs like mint and lavender. These fragrant plants not only add charm to your yard however also function as reliable bug deterrents. Bugs like insects, flies, and even some garden-damaging bugs are fended off by the strong aromas produced by these herbs. Just putting them purposefully around your garden can assist develop an all-natural barrier against unwanted insects.

Along with mint and lavender, think about growing various other natural herbs like rosemary, basil, and lemongrass to even more improve your garden's pest-proofing abilities. These herbs not only work as natural repellents yet additionally have the added benefit of working in cooking or crafting homemade solutions.

Strategic Plant Placement



Take into consideration the design of your yard and the types of plants you need to strategically put them for maximum pest-proofing effectiveness.

Begin by grouping plants with similar resistance to parasites together. By doing this, you can develop a natural obstacle that prevents pests from spreading throughout your yard.



In addition, placing pest-repelling plants like marigolds, lavender, or mint near more prone plants can help secure them. High plants, such as sunflowers or corn, can act as a guard for shorter plants against parasites like bunnies or ground-dwelling bugs.

Remember to leave enough space in between plants to improve air blood circulation and reduce the risk of conditions that pests could bring.

Additionally, take into consideration planting strong-smelling herbs like rosemary or basil near prone plants to confuse bugs' senses and make it harder for them to situate their targets.

Effective Bug Control Approaches



For combating yard bugs properly, implementing a multi-faceted insect control technique is necessary. Beginning by motivating natural predators like birds, ladybugs, and hoping mantises to aid keep insect populations in check. Introducing plants that attract these beneficial bugs can help in bug control. Additionally, exercising excellent garden health by eliminating particles and weeds where bugs could hide can make your yard much less hospitable to unwanted site visitors.

Think about making use of physical obstacles such as row cover fabrics or netting to shield vulnerable plants from parasites like caterpillars and birds. Applying natural pesticides like neem oil or insecticidal soap can additionally work versus specific parasites while being less harmful to beneficial insects and the atmosphere. It's important to revolve your plants each period to stop the buildup of parasite populations that target specific plants.
